Hajj 2026: CSO seeks special committee to oversee Hady (animal sacrifice)

By Sadiq Abdulfatah

Independent Hajj Reporters (IHR) has called for the establishment of a special committee to oversee the payment and implementation of Hadaya (animal sacrifice) for Nigerian pilgrims in the 2026 Hajj.

The group said the move is necessary to prevent a recurrence of the alleged irregularities recorded during the 2025 pilgrimage.

In a statement signed by its national coordinator, Ibrahim Muhammad, IHR noted that the conduct of Hadaya has remained a contentious issue, often plagued by lack of transparency and accountability.

According to the group, the arrangement allowing Jaiz Bank to facilitate Hadaya payments through an Islamic Development Bank-approved platform has not fully addressed the challenges. Many pilgrims still prefer to pay via some state pilgrims boards.

It alleged that while some states maintain transparency, others divert funds meant for Hady, thereby denying pilgrims the fulfilment of a key religious obligation.

The group also called for uniformity in the charges for Hadaya across all states, noting that disparities currently exist despite uniform Hajj fares based on flight zones.

IHR further observed that although the Saudi Ministry of Hajj and Umrah had integrated Hadaya into the Hajj payment system, Nigeria was yet to fully comply, leaving room for states to manage this year’s Hady project.

It urged the National Hajj Commission of Nigeria to set up a dedicated committee to regulate the process as part of its renewed efforts to strengthen oversight and accountability in the Hajj industry.
